Website. www.nku.edu. Northern Kentucky University is a public university in Highland Heights, Kentucky. Of its 15,000 students, over 10,000 are undergraduate students and nearly 5,000 are graduate students. nkunorse.com. The Northern Kentucky Norse are the athletic teams of Northern Kentucky University, located in Highland Heights, Kentucky, United States. NKU is an NCAA Division I school competing in the Horizon League, which it joined on July 1, 2015, after leaving the Atlantic Sun Conference. [2] The university's teams for both men and women ...

The following is a list of Northern Kentucky Norse men's basketball head coaches. There have been six head coaches of the Norse in their 52-season history. [1] Northern Kentucky's current head coach is Darrin Horn. He was hired as the Norse's head coach in April 2019, [2] replacing John Brannen, who left to become the head coach at Cincinnati. [3]
The 2018–19 Northern Kentucky Norse men's basketball team represented Northern Kentucky University (NKU) during the 2018–19 NCAA Division I men's basketball season.The Norse, led by fourth-year head coach John Brannen, played their home games at BB&T Arena in Highland Heights, Kentucky as members of the Horizon League.
